Parking at a Wrexham COVID-19 vaccination centre is expected to get busy tomorrow (Tuesday, October 10) and over the next few weeks.
Betsi Cadwaladr University Health Board (BCUHB) have issued an update on parking at the Catrin Finch Centre, which is limited due to building work, university students and preparations for the Wales v Gibraltar match at the STōK Cae Ras.
A spokesperson said: “We’re asking people travelling by car to remain patient and follow the signs on site. Please keep to your scheduled appointment time and do not arrive early, as this could make parking more difficult for others attending the clinic.

“Patients who arrive late for their appointment because of difficulty parking will still receive their vaccine, but may have a short wait until a member of our team becomes available.”
They added: “As a result of building work, a large number of parking spaces at the Catrin Finch Centre are currently unavailable. Students returning to campus at Wrexham University have significantly increased demand for parking, while further spaces are taken up by preparations being made for the Wales v Gibraltar football match at the Racecourse Ground on Wednesday (October 11).
“We anticipate that pressure on car parking will be greatest on Tuesday and Thursday this week, and on the following two Thursdays (October 19 and October 26). Please share this message with family or friends who are attending a COVID-19 Autumn booster vaccination appointment in Wrexham on these dates.”
